This compact two-bedroom end-of-terrace sits in a quiet Laindon cul-de-sac and suits first-time buyers or downsizers seeking a well-located, low-maintenance home. The living space is bright and practical, with a kitchen/dining area that opens onto a private rear garden — a useful extension of the footprint given the property's small overall size (approximately 496 sq ft).
Upstairs offers a master bedroom with fitted wardrobes, a good-sized second bedroom and a single family bathroom. The house was constructed around 1996–2002, has cavity walls (assumed insulated), double glazing (install date unknown) and a gas-fired boiler with radiators. Broadband speeds are fast and mobile signal is excellent, supporting home working and streaming.
Outside there are two designated off-street parking bays plus additional space, and a low-maintenance rear garden. Local amenities include nearby primary and secondary schools rated Good by Ofsted, bus links and local shops — handy for everyday life and school runs. Crime and area deprivation levels are average, and council tax banding is affordable.
Important practical notes: the property is small and may feel tight for some households; it has only one bathroom. Buyers should verify the age and condition of glazing and the boiler if long-term replacement costs are a concern.
